Magnetic media and sputter targets with compositions of high anisotropy alloys and oxide compounds are provided to reduce the size of each magnetic domain on a storage layer of medium by using a high anisotropy constant as material. A magnetic media with compositions of high anisotropy alloys and oxide compounds comprises a magnetic storage layer(106) having a first alloy and oxide compounds having oxygen and more than one element. The first alloy has an anisotropy constant of at least 0.5x10^7 ergs/cm^3. The first alloy is also selected from a group consisting of L10-type ordered intermetallics, ordered HCP intermetallics, and rare earth transited metallics. The oxide compounds are deposited in an oxide-rich grain boundary isolating a magnetic grain boundary of the first alloy. The first alloy is selected from a group consisting of FePt, FePd CoPt, Mnal, Co3Pt, SmCo5, and Fe14Nd2B.
